start my pt cruiser up and it die .try to restat it and will not start light work and radio work. chagne out old batt for new one. still wioll not start

Try the Camshaft Position Sensor. Chrysler 2.4's have a history of this part failing. It is a $20-$30 part at you local auto parts store and a 5 minute job with either an 8 or 10 mm socket.
